On Fri, Sep 14, 2018 at 12:37:40PM +0200, Moritz Muehlenhoff wrote: > I've pulled a number of upstream commits for the megaraid_sas driver which add > support for the Perc 740/840 RAID controllers to the Stretch kernel. > > Successfully tested with a H840 on a current Dell PowerEdge R440 and I've also tested > the built kernel on a system which was previously supported by the megaraid_sas > driver (LSI MegaRAID SAS 2008 (Perc H310 Mini)) and that continues to work fine > as well. > > Test debs (I'd appreciate more tests on MegaRAID controllers, the 740 should be > identical to the 840 except that it allows for less drives) are at > https://people.debian.org/~jmm/perc/ I've tried your kernel on a R740 with Buster userland (I did not find an easy way to build a new Stretch debian-installer image with the updated kernel) and it works just fine. > Merge request at https://salsa.debian.org/kernel-team/linux/merge_requests/61 There have been a few style comments by Ben Hutchings.
